Seán [ ʃɔːn ] or (in anglicized spelling without acute ) Sean is a male (rarely female) given name .

Origin and meaning

Seán is the Irish form of Johannes (English form John ).

The name comes from the time of the Norman Anglo-conquest of Ireland-down French name Jean , Old French Jehan (via Latin Johannes , ancient Greek Ἰωάννης (JOHN) from the Hebrew יוֹחָנָן (Johanan), meaning these names root "God is gracious").

The female equivalent with the same meaning in Irish is Siobhán [ ʃəˈvɔːn ], in English Joan or Jane and in Welsh Siân or Sian [ ʃɑːn ].
